Ionic systems are based on the principles of ionics, a branch of science that deals with the behavior of ions, or charged particles, in various materials Ions are atoms or molecules that have gained or lost electrons, giving them a positive or negative charge By harnessing the power of these charged particles, ionic systems can perform a wide range of tasks that were once thought to be impossible.
One of the most well-known examples of ionic systems is the lithium-ion battery These batteries, which are used in everything from smartphones to electric vehicles, rely on the movement of lithium ions between the positive and negative electrodes to store and release energy This technology has revolutionized the way we power our devices, providing longer battery life and faster charging times than ever before.
